Understanding Tesla Paint and Body Integrity Standards

Tesla vehicles are renowned for their sleek design and advanced technology, but maintaining the integrity of their paint and bodywork is a specialized task. Tesla-trained technicians play a pivotal role in preserving the aesthetic excellence of these cars. Understanding Tesla’s strict paint and body integrity standards is paramount to ensuring these vehicles remain in pristine condition.
Tesla sets unparalleled benchmarks for vehicle paint repair and auto maintenance, with a focus on precision and longevity. Their paint protection systems are designed to resist chips, scratches, and fading, but even the most careful drivers can encounter car scratch repair scenarios. Tesla-trained technicians are equipped with advanced training and specialized tools to address these issues effectively. For instance, they employ state-of-the-art paint mixing techniques to match the exact color and finish of the vehicle, ensuring a seamless restoration.
Regular auto maintenance is key to preserving Tesla’s high standards. Technicians perform thorough inspections, identifying potential issues before they become visible. This proactive approach includes checking for moisture intrusion, which can cause rust and corrosion behind paint, as well as inspecting body panels for signs of misalignment after repairs. By adhering to these meticulous practices, Tesla-trained technicians contribute to the overall longevity and value of each vehicle.
When car scratch repair or more significant body work is required, owners should seek out certified Tesla technicians. Their expertise ensures that any repairs are executed with the utmost care, maintaining the vehicle’s original integrity. This commitment to quality not only preserves the car’s appearance but also its resale value, as potential buyers expect the highest standards from a premium brand like Tesla.
Training and Expertise: Tesla-Trained Technicians

Tesla’s commitment to innovation extends beyond its electric powertrains; it encompasses every aspect of their vehicles, including paint and body integrity. To ensure the meticulous craftsmanship that defines Tesla cars, the company has developed a specialized training program for technicians focused exclusively on preserving the unique aesthetics of these advanced machines. These Tesla-trained technicians are the unsung heroes behind the scenes, meticulously honing their skills to address complex auto collision repair needs while maintaining the pristine appearance of Tesla vehicles.
The rigorous training regimen involves in-depth study of Tesla’s proprietary paint and body repair methods, which incorporate cutting-edge technologies like robot-assisted painting and advanced composite materials. Technicians learn not only the technical aspects but also the subtleties of color matching and finish perfection, crucial for minimizing visible imperfections that could detract from a Tesla’s distinctive design. This specialized knowledge allows them to expertly handle everything from minor dent removal to extensive collision repair, ensuring each vehicle leaves the auto collision center looking as good as new.
Industry data reveals that properly trained technicians can significantly reduce repaint requirements and enhance customer satisfaction with the final results. By harnessing the expertise of Tesla-trained specialists, auto collision centers are equipped to provide unparalleled service for these high-tech vehicles. Whether it’s addressing minor dents or substantial damage from a collision, these technicians employ their sophisticated skills to preserve not just the structural integrity but also the visual allure that has become synonymous with Tesla automobiles.
Best Practices for Preserving Vehicle Condition

Tesla-trained technicians play a pivotal role in preserving the iconic integrity of Tesla vehicles, particularly when it comes to paint and body work. Given the unique design aesthetics and advanced materials employed by Tesla, specialized knowledge and skillsets are essential for maintaining their pristine condition. Best practices for preserving vehicle condition involve meticulous attention to detail, utilizing state-of-the-art equipment, and adhering to stringent quality standards.
In a collision repair center or dedicated vehicle body repair shop, Tesla-trained technicians are equipped to handle even the most intricate tasks. They employ advanced techniques for car scratch repair, ensuring minimal impact on the overall finish. For instance, utilizing ceramic coating technology can significantly enhance paint protection, repelling contaminants and minimizing the need for frequent touch-ups. These professionals also possess expertise in color matching, crucial for repairs that blend seamlessly with the original factory paint.
Data suggests that proper vehicle body repair techniques can extend the lifespan of a car’s paint job by years. Tesla-trained technicians understand the importance of preserving not just the exterior, but also the overall integrity of the vehicle. By implementing best practices, they can minimize damage during repairs, maintain structural integrity, and ensure the car retains its original beauty—a testament to the craftsmanship that goes into every Tesla. Ultimately, their work fosters customer satisfaction, assuring owners that their vehicles remain as stunning and reliable as the day they left the factory.
